About 20 years ago we had a 92 Lumina Z34 that we had purchased new. It went through brakes every 18,000 miles....only the inboard pad on the left front wheel was worn down to nothing....the other 3 front pads looked like new. The first time, I replaced everything myself &quot;the right way&quot;....all new hardware, everything properly lubricated, yada yada. After doing that same thing again, I took it back to the dealership where I bought it and had been trading for years. They ended up having the Zone service rep come in and check it out after I got no satisfaction from them. His opinion? &quot;Normal wear&quot;. Wrong answer, chump. Soon afterward I traded the POS in on a new 95 Eldorado and our brake problems were over....got over 60K miles on the original front brake pads on that.
